sysctl - Manage entries in sysctl.conf.

Synopsis

This module manipulates sysctl entries and optionally performs a /sbin/sysctl -p after changing them.

        Examples

        # Set vm.swappiness to 5 in /etc/sysctl.conf
        - sysctl: name=vm.swappiness value=5 state=present
        
        # Remove kernel.panic entry from /etc/sysctl.conf
        - sysctl: name=kernel.panic state=absent sysctl_file=/etc/sysctl.conf
        
        # Set kernel.panic to 3 in /tmp/test_sysctl.conf
        - sysctl: name=kernel.panic value=3 sysctl_file=/tmp/test_sysctl.conf reload=no
        
        # Set ip forwarding on in /proc and do not reload the sysctl file
        - sysctl: name="net.ipv4.ip_forward" value=1 sysctl_set=yes
        
        # Set ip forwarding on in /proc and in the sysctl file and reload if necessary
        - sysctl: name="net.ipv4.ip_forward" value=1 sysctl_set=yes state=present reload=yes
